What Is Unified Risk Automation?

Unified risk automation refers to combining AML automation, sanctions screening, fraud detection, and compliance monitoring into one connected system.
Traditionally, banks managed these functions separately. AML teams, fraud teams, and sanctions monitoring units often used different tools, workflows, and databases. This created operational silos and delayed investigations.
Today, financial services automation is moving toward integrated risk automation platforms that allow banks to monitor threats through a single system.
Unified automation improves:

  • Risk visibility
  • Investigation speed
  • Alert management
  • Regulatory reporting
  • Customer risk analysis
  • Operational efficiency
    This approach strengthens banking automation while reducing duplicate work across teams.

Why Banks Need Unified Risk Automation

Modern financial institutions handle massive transaction volumes every day. Digital banking, online payments, mobile transfers, and global transactions have increased the complexity of risk management.
Managing AML automation, sanctions screening, and fraud prevention systems separately creates several problems.

Fragmented Data

Different systems often store customer data separately. This limits visibility across banking operations.
For example, a customer flagged in fraud prevention systems may not immediately appear in AML automation workflows.

Duplicate Investigations

Multiple teams may investigate the same customer activity independently. This increases operational costs and slows response times.

Delayed Risk Detection

Disconnected systems reduce the ability to identify linked suspicious activities quickly.
Unified compliance monitoring improves overall detection speed.

Regulatory Pressure

Regulators expect stronger controls, better reporting, and improved risk management processes.
Banks must demonstrate consistent oversight across all compliance areas.

How Unified Risk Automation Works

Unified risk automation combines multiple monitoring processes into a centralized system.
These platforms continuously analyze:

  • Customer transactions
  • Account activity
  • Payment patterns
  • Geographic activity
  • Device behavior
  • Sanctions databases
  • Historical risk profiles
    AI in banking helps these systems process large datasets efficiently while identifying suspicious patterns in real time.

The Role of AML Automation

AML automation helps banks identify potential money laundering activities.
Modern systems monitor customer transactions continuously and flag unusual behavior patterns.
AML automation supports:

  • Customer due diligence
  • Ongoing transaction monitoring
  • Risk scoring
  • Suspicious activity reporting
  • Compliance documentation
    Artificial intelligence in banking improves AML monitoring by identifying hidden transaction relationships and unusual financial behavior that traditional systems may miss.

How Sanctions Screening Supports Compliance

Sanctions screening helps banks identify customers, businesses, or transactions linked to restricted entities or high-risk jurisdictions.
Banks must comply with international sanctions regulations to avoid financial penalties and reputational damage.
Automated sanctions screening systems compare customer data against:

  • Government watchlists
  • Global sanctions databases
  • Politically exposed person lists
  • Regulatory databases
    Unified risk automation improves sanctions screening accuracy by connecting customer risk data across systems.

Fraud Prevention Systems in Banking

Fraud prevention systems monitor transactions and customer behavior to identify suspicious activity.
AI-powered fraud prevention systems analyze:

  • Login behavior
  • Device usage
  • Transaction timing
  • Payment patterns
  • Geographic inconsistencies
  • Account behavior changes
    These systems improve fraud detection accuracy while reducing false alerts.
    Unified banking process automation allows fraud teams and compliance teams to work with shared intelligence instead of isolated data.

Benefits of Unified Risk Automation

Better Risk Visibility

Unified systems provide a complete view of customer activity across multiple risk categories.
This helps banks identify complex financial crime patterns more effectively.

Faster Investigations

Connected workflows allow teams to investigate alerts more efficiently.
Investigators spend less time gathering data from separate systems.

Reduced False Positives

AI-driven risk automation platforms improve alert quality and reduce unnecessary investigations.

Improved Compliance Monitoring

Banks maintain stronger audit trails, reporting accuracy, and regulatory oversight using centralized systems.

Lower Operational Costs

Automation in financial services reduces repetitive manual work and improves operational efficiency.

Challenges in Unified Risk Automation

Although unified systems provide many benefits, banks still face implementation challenges.

Legacy Infrastructure

Older banking systems may not integrate easily with modern automation platforms.

Data Quality Issues

Incomplete or inconsistent customer records affect monitoring accuracy.

Governance Requirements

Banks must ensure proper oversight, transparency, and explainability within AI systems.

Operational Change

Unified automation often requires teams to adjust workflows and collaborate more closely across departments.
